Cannot declare variable of static type type
WebMay 29, 2012 · static variables are used when only one copy of the variable is required. so if you declare variable inside the method there is no use of such variable it's become local to function only.. example of … WebOct 4, 2009 · Simply put it this way: in a statically typed language variables' types are static, meaning once you set a variable to a type, you cannot change it. That is because typing is associated with the variable rather than the value it refers to. ... like having something to do with the way in which you declare or don't declare variables; data …
Cannot declare variable of static type type
Did you know?
Web16 hours ago · I have code that I think is using static members incorrectly. An example is below. Variable types and names might not make sense. public class subclass extends superclass { private static Boolean WebJul 20, 2015 · Cannot declare variable of static type 'type'. Instances of static types cannot be created. The following sample generates CS0723: // CS0723.cs public static class SC { } public class CMain { public static void Main () { SC sc = null; // CS0723 } }
WebOct 3, 2024 · A static method cannot contain any local static variable. Static methods cannot access any non-static variables unless they are explicitly passed as parameters. A static method can contain ref and out parameters. A static method can only be assessed by the type name itself, not by the type object. WebAug 30, 2013 · 8. Java does not let you define non-final static fields inside function-local inner classes. Only top-level classes and static nested classes are allowed to have non-final static fields. If you want a static field in your Constants class, put it at the Application class level, like this: public class Application { static final class Constants ...
WebFeb 28, 2024 · The type name cannot be specified in the variable declaration because only the compiler has access to the underlying name of the anonymous type. ... or the return type of a method as having an anonymous type. Similarly, you cannot declare a formal parameter of a method, property, constructor, or indexer as having an anonymous type. … WebAug 13, 2013 · The auto type-specifier can also be used in declaring a variable in the condition of a selection statement (6.4) or an iteration statement (6.5), in the type-specifier-seq in the new-type-id or type-id of a new-expression (5.3.4), in a for-range-declaration, and in declaring a static data member with a brace-or-equal-initializer that appears ...
Weba. A class's instance variables override locally declared variables with the same names that are declared within the class's methods. b. You cannot declare the same variable name more than once within a block, even if a block contains other blocks. c. A variable ceases to exist, or goes out of scope, at the end of the block in which it is declared.
WebJun 17, 2024 · if ( v == null) return; v.vfx.Play(); } } Whenever I write something like that: FindObjectOfType ().Play ("bla") I get: static types cannot be used as … the pennstater breakfast buffetWebSep 14, 2024 · The Visual Basic compiler uses the Dim statement to determine the variable's data type and other information, such as what code can access the variable. The following example declares a variable to hold an Integer value. You can specify any data type or the name of an enumeration, structure, class, or interface. the penn stroudWebBecause your Program class (just like everything else in your code, seems like) is defined as static - which means that you cannot create a new instance of it. And you can't declare a variable of type Program, again, because it is static. Share Improve this answer Follow … the penn surgery elm roadWebSep 15, 2024 · Cannot declare variable of static type 'type' Instances of static types cannot be created. The following sample generates CS0723: // CS0723.cs public static class … the penn state university addressWebNov 28, 2010 · You can work around that by slightly changing your design and embedding a pointer (or a smart pointer, if you can use those) to an instance of I1 instead: class M1 : public G1 { protected: I1 *sc; public: M1 (I1 *sc_) { sc = … siam toulouse 2022WebApr 10, 2024 · C Variable Syntax. data_type variable_name = value; // defining single variable or data_type variable_name1, variable_name2; // defining multiple variable. Here, data_type: Type of data that a variable can store. variable_name: Name of the variable given by the user. value: value assigned to the variable by the user. Variable … the pennsylvania avenue baptist church pabcWebMar 9, 2024 · Static methods and properties cannot access non-static fields and events in their containing type, and they cannot access an instance variable of any object unless it's explicitly passed in a method parameter. It is more typical to declare a non-static class with some static members, than to declare an entire class as static. siam touch thai massage farmington hills mi